Jerry Lane, Presto Conductor
Jerry Lane is a musician and teacher with 35 years of public school orchestra experience. He has taught for the Pulaski County (central Arkansas), Pine Bluff, Fort Smith and Rogers school districts. He has directed orchestras at the University of Arkansas (12 years) and University of Central Arkansas (4 years) summer orchestra camps. He has directed numerous All Region orchestras as well. He is currently an adjunct faculty member of the University of Arkansas at Fort Smith. He is also currently the principal bassist for the Fort Smith Symphony and the Arkansas Philharmonic Orchestra. He has extensive experience as a bassist for rock, jazz, country, bluegrass and big bands.
He holds a BSE in Instrumental Music from the University of Arkansas where he played in both the orchestra and the Razorback band (saxophone). He also has a MSE in Educational Administration from the University of Arkansas at Little Rock.
Mr. Lane enjoys the outdoors via biking, hiking, kayaking and fishing. He is married to Greta Lane. He is a native of McAlester, Oklahoma.
